Ancestors of Elizabeth Bullock
Generation No. 1
1. Elizabeth Bullock, born Abt. 1670; died in MD. She was the daughter of 2. John
Bullock and 3. Catherine Assiter. She married (1) Arthur Joseph Alvey Bef. 1690 in SMC,
MD (Source: Maryland Calandar of Wills, 3:502, 10:17). He was the son of Joseph Alvey and
Elizabeth Unknown. She married (2) William Cissell Bet. 1688 - 1692 in SMC, MD. He was
the son of John Baptist Cissell and Mary Calvert.
Notes for Arthur Joseph Alvey:
From Robert Lee Alvey: Arthur is thought to be the oldest child of
Joseph & Elizabeth. Mary Louise Donnelly, an avid St. Mary's Co, MD researcher,
believes that Arthur's son is a younger son of Joseph and Elizabeth and prints as such
in her book "Early settlers of St. Clement's Bay". Nothing should be
dismissed but I, along with several other Alvey researchers, continue to have some
problems with the timeline for this to be fact and until something documentable is found,
I will continue to show him as Arthur's only child.
Notes for William Cissell:
By his marriage to Catherine Joyner he came into possession of 100 acres of
"Scotland". William married secondly Elizabeth Bullock Alvey, the daughter of
John and ? Assiter, and the widow of Arthur Alvey, with no children. In 1701 William
administered the estate of Arthur Alvey )Acc't 21:382). William acquired an
additional 100 acres of "Scotland" which was resurveyed for him on 12/10/1714
and patented to him on 9/10/1716.
William Cissell, a planter, wrote his will 22 Jun 1742 and was admitted to probate on 28
Nov 1744.(24:2-4) To his son Arthur he left 100 acres of "Scotland", and to his
granddaughter Elinor (daughter of Arthur) he left the land between Arthur's plantation
and where John Harden now lives. To his son Luke he left the other part of
"Scotland", 50 acres he had obtained by "Judgement in Chancery". He
left his daughters Margaret Thompson and Ann Edwards the plantations where they were
living. To his son Matthew he left the plantation where he was living, which was 50 acres
of "White Acres", William had inherited from his father, plus Clare his wife he
left a shilling. To his daughter Elizabeth, the wife of Charles Payne, he left the land
between William Cissell's and Ann Edward's, deeded from her brother William
Cissell's land. To his daughter Clare Barton he left one acre now in possession of
William Cissell's son John. To his daughter in law Elizabeth___, now married to

les Neal, he left access to William Cissell's land. His children were all named as
his heirs.
William is mentioned in the will of his father, John Cissell, dated 28 April 1694.
Notes of March 1697/1698 as recorded in the annals of PGC, MD, a William Cecil "by
the request of my wife as she lay upon her deathbed " disposed of his children John,
age 7, Phillip, age 5, and Susan, age 2, to Mareen Duval (the Elder) and his wife. May be
a different William-as it is, there seems to be no real agreement on which children
belonged to which wife.
Appears property was received from his brothers Richard Cecil and Robert Cecil, of 100
acres, since they both had died young if had come to him, ref: Elise Greenup Jordan,
Early Families of Southern Maryland, Vol. 1.
Child of Elizabeth Bullock and Arthur Alvey is:
i. John Alvey, born Abt. 1690 in SMC, MD; died Bef. 21-Apr-1743 in SMC, MD; married Mary
Clarke Abt. 1718 in SMC, MD.
Children of Elizabeth Bullock and William Cissell are:
i. Arthur Cissell, born Bet. 1687 - 1694 in SMC, MD; died 1737 in St. Mary's Co, MD;
married Mary Doyne Bet. 1722 - 1724.
Notes for Arthur Cissell:
He was born in St. Mary's County, Maryland. He received 100 acres of
"Scotland" as a legacy from his father. His daughter Elinor also received a
small plot of land as her legacy from her grandfather's will.
Arthur wrote his will on 11/5/1737 (27:355). To his two sons, John and James, he left
"land my father William has willed to me" and a tract called
"Scotland". His wife Mary was named as his executrix. The other children were
named in the will of their brother James. Mary administered the estate on 10/30/1750,
valued at L113.07.07. The next of kin on his inventory were his sons John and James
(44:231)

Notes for Mary Thompson:
Sr Donnelly's book "Colonial Settlers St Clements Bay she states:
Matthew Cissell was born in St Mary's County, Md, the son of William Cissell and
Elizabeth Bullock Alvey. He married Mary Thompson, the daughter of James Thompson and
Ruth______. Mary Cissell was named next of kin on the inventory of her father James
Thompson. She had a brother named Ignatius Thompson.
Matthew Cissell was deceased by 5/30/1748 when Mary Cissell administered his estate. The
next of kin on his inventory were his sons Arthur Cissell and James Cissell. Matthew
Cissell had 43 acres of "Addition to White Acres" which on 3/30/1748 was
patented to Thomas Cissell, his son.
